What is a Registered Agent?
A designated agent is an individual or business designated to accept critical legal documents on behalf of a business. This vital role guarantees that a company can be easily contacted for notifications like lawsuits, tax documents, and formal government correspondence. By having a trustworthy registered agent, a business can ensure compliance with state regulations and remain updated about legal responsibilities.
The registered agent must have a physical address within the region where the company is incorporated, acting as the official point of contact between the business and local government. This is particularly significant for Limited Liability Companies and corporations, as each organization is required to appoint a registered agent to meet compliance needs. Failing to have a registered agent can lead to fines or deterioration in reputation with the state.
Companies can opt to engage a professional registered agent provider to handle these responsibilities. This offers several advantages, including confidentiality, as the agent's location is publicly listed instead of the owner's personal address. Additionally, these services often provide nationwide coverage, ensuring reliable assistance regardless of where the company operates.

Agent of Record Responsibilities and Compliance
Agents of record play a vital role in making certain that a entity complies to regulatory standards. Their main responsibility is to receive official documents on behalf of the business, such as financial notices, legal notifications, and state regulatory notices. This role makes certain that the company is informed and can react suitably to legal matters, thus helping uphold a positive status with the state. A dependable agent of record is necessary for on-time delivery and management of these documents.
In addition to accepting documents, registered agents must also keep up-to-date records and keep their details current with the designated state authorities. This is paramount for compliance purposes. Failing to maintain proper records or letting details become outdated can lead to serious consequences for a business, including penalties or even the risk for closure in extreme cases. Therefore, thorough attention to these obligations is essential.
Moreover, agents of record must comprehend the laws particular to the jurisdiction in which a business operates. Every state may have various regulations regarding agents of record, including standards and duties. Familiarity with these legal requirements helps prevent legal setbacks and guarantees that the business remains in good standing. Price Comparison of Registered Agent Services
In evaluating registered agent services, a key factor to consider is cost. Prices for registered agent services can vary significantly according to the provider, the level of service offered, and the details of your business. While some companies might provide their services at a premium, others aim to attract clients with budget-friendly choices. Generally, the yearly expense of hiring a registered agent can vary from a minimum of 50 to more than 500 dollars per year, so it's crucial to assess what the offerings are at different price levels.
Affordable registration services often provide essential features, including receiving legal documents and maintaining a registered office, whereas more comprehensive options might include additional services like compliance tracking and document forwarding.
